First, believe.
Believe that Jesus is the Christ, the Son of the Living
God who died for your sins and offers salvation as a free gift for all who put
their trust in Him. To believe means to recognize that you have not lived
up to the standard God desired for you. The Bible’s word for this is
sin. Everyone, who has walked this
earth, except Jesus, has sinned.
(Romans 3:23) Second, repent of your sins.
To repent means to change your mind. It means to
turn away from your sins and turn toward God. You cannot turn away
from something without turning
to something else. Decide today
that you no longer want to live life doing your own thing, but that you want to
follow God's path instead. Third, confess that Jesus Christ is Lord. “That if you confess with your mouth, ‘Jesus is Lord,’ and believe in your heart that God raised Him from the dead, you will be saved.” (Romans 10:9) Fourth, be baptized into Christ.
To be baptized, based on the Scriptural method, means to
be immersed with water. It is a symbol of the death, burial, and
resurrection of Jesus Christ, reminding us that when we are saved, we die to our
selves and are raised to live a new life in Christ. “Or don't you know that all of us who were baptized into Christ Jesus were baptized into his death? We were therefore buried with him through baptism into death in order that, just as Christ was raised from the dead through the glory of the Father, we too may live a new life.” (Romans 6:3-4) Questions about baptism?
